The Science Behind Basement Water Removal: How We Get the Job Done
Proper Basement Water Removal needs a precise process to ensure the water is completely extracted, and the area is thoroughly dried. Our team follows a step-by-step approach to guarantee your basement is safe and functional once again.
Step 1: Containment
Our technicians will seal off the affected area to prevent further water damage and contamination. This step is crucial in preventing the spread of mold and mildew.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using heavy-duty pumps and wet vacuums, we’ll ext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ing drying times.
Step 3: Drying
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ry the area,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ring the area is completely dry.
Step 4: Sanitizing
Our technicians will use antimicrobial treatments to sanitize the area and prevent mold and mildew growth.
Step 5: Restoration
Once the area is dry and sanitized, we’ll work with you to restore your basement to its original condition.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ged drywall, flooring, or other materials.

Warning Signs You Need Basement Water Removal
Ignoring the warning signs of Basement Water Removal can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Don’t wait until it’s too late, be aware of these common signs and take action immediately.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ty smell in your basement is a clear indication of moisture and potential mold growth. Don’t ignore it, call our team to investigate and address the issue.
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Visible water stains on walls and ceilings are a sign of a more significant problem. Our technicians will work to identify the source and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ring is a sign of excessive moisture, which can compromise the structural integrity of your home. Don’t delay, contact us to address the issue.
Visible Mold Growth
Visible mold growth is a serious health risk and can be a sign of a more significant problem. Our team will work to identify the source and provide a solution to prevent further growth.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ks in your home’s foundation or walls can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it, call our team to investigate and address the issue.
High Humidity Levels
High humidity levels in your basement can lead to mold growth and other issues. Our technicians will work to identify the source and provide a solution to reduce humidity levels.

Basement Water Removal Cost in Salley, SC
The cost of Basement Water Removal in Salley, SC can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on the extent of the damage and the resources required to restore your basement.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and equipment required |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and equipment required |
| Sanitizing and dis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of treatment required |
| Restoration and rep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Scope of work and materials required |
| Containment and setup |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and equipment required |
| Monitoring and inspection | $200 – $1,000 | Frequency and duration of monitoring required |
